noun. Someone who has previously worked as a bike messenger but is no longer earning a living from it.
A portmanteau of the prefix "
ex-" and "messenger", an exenger may or may not wear the clothing or equipment associated with
bicycle couriers.
Typically, an exenger will have the skills and experience to distinguish themselves from a fakenger or a posenger. This is sometimes not immediately apparent, especially if the cyclist is a Fixie La
Douche style of exenger.
